As a member of the team in one of the world's leading defence, security and aerospace companies, you will be part of the development and supply of products across a diverse mix of commercial and military platforms; Head Up and Head Worn Displays, Safety Critical Pilot Control and Flight Control Systems.

This is an extremely exciting and challenging role and will present the opportunity to design products for the world's most advanced commercial and military fixed wing and rotary wing aircraft. Exposure to the customer and end user, as well as working alongside like-minded engineers, makes this a unique opportunity for the right candidate.

Your main responsibilities as a Senior Software Engineer will involve:

  • Pick up initial requirement, use a design methodology - UML, Object design methodology, develop an architecture and design using code to implement, move into a verification stage, and take the code to prove that the software meets the intention of its design.

  • Integrate software on hardware, have experience of low-level interaction with hardware

  • Willingness to own your own continuous development with built in determination to continue to develop.

Your skills and qualifications:

  • Degree or equivalent qualification in a Scientific/Engineering (electronics-engineering, software-engineering, physics, maths) environment

  • Expert Software Engineering skills, with extensive experience in C/C++/Ada

  • Expert at Software Architecture and Detailed Design using UML or other recognised model-based design techniques

  • Developed embedded software for bare metal systems or with Real-Time Operating Systems

  • Interfaced software with hardware in a real-time environment
